To Bats In The Belfry Meaning. ‘bats in the belfry’ refers to someone who acts as though he has bats careering around his topmost part, that is, his head. Have bats in the belfry. Have bats in the belfry. Have bats in the belfry. Tommy must have bats in the belfry if he thinks he can. The meaning of bats in the belfry is mentally unsound or very eccentric.
